Update - Unlawful entry - Livingstone

Police

Northern Territory Police have charged a 39-year-old man in relation to an alleged theft in Livingstone earlier this year.

It is believed that some time prior to 13 April, a disused factory was unlawfully entered, with its contents, a commercial bottling plant, allegedly stolen.

Detectives from the Serious Crime Squad charged the man yesterday with unlawful entry and aggravated stealing.

He was bailed and is scheduled to appear in Darwin Local Court on 15 November 2018.
